Description

Partial Search is a new search API currently available only on Opscode Hosted Chef that can be used to reduce the network bandwidth and the memory used by chef-client to process search results.

This cookbook provides an experimental interface to the partial search API by providing a partial_search method that can be used instead of the search method in your recipes.

The partial_search method allows you to retrieve just the attributes of interest. For example, you can execute a search to return just the name and IP addresses of the nodes in your infrastructure rather than receiving an array of complete node objects and post-processing them.

Finally, both the search and partial_search methods allow you to cache results to avoid repetitive queries for the same search terms.

Install

Upload this cookbook and include it in the dependencies of any cookbook where you would like to use partial_search.

Usage

When you call partial_search, you need to specify the key paths of the attributes you want returned. Key paths are specified as an array of strings. Each key path is mapped to a short name of your choosing. Consider the following example:

partial_search(:node, 'role:web',
   :keys => { 'name' => [ 'name' ],
              'ip'   => [ 'ipaddress' ],
              'kernel_version' => [ 'kernel', 'version' ]
            }
).each do |result|
  puts result['name']
  puts result['ip']
  puts result['kernel_version']
end

In the example above, two attributes will be extracted (on the server) from the nodes that match the search query. The result will be a simple hash with keys 'name' and 'ip'.

The :cache option allows you to retrieve cached search results if available. If an identical query was already issued during the current Chef run, its results will be immediately returned, thereby avoiding an unnecessary round-trip to the server. For example:

partial_search(:node, 'role:web', :cache => true, :keys => ... )

Notes

  • We would like your feedback on this feature and the interface provided by this cookbook. Please send comments to the chef-dev mailing list.

  • The partial search API will eventually be available in the Open Source Chef Server.

  • The partial search API is available in Opscode Private Chef since 1.2.2
